UK wave watcher gets drenched by mountain of white water

Gale force winds gusting up to 65 mph sent huge waves smashing into Penzance's promenade this evening (November 9).

The spectacular display of mountainous waves, known locally as 'Cornish Fireworks', brings many locals and visitors to the normally tranquil promenade.

The man in this clip got dressed up in wet weather gear to get an immersive experience with the sea.

He'd clearly done it before as he was wearing a helmet underneath the oilskins to protect himself from the stones that are thrown up by the powerful storm swells.
